Continued Care Following Short Term Drug and Alcohol Treatment in Wayne, Maine

One of the advantages when you complete short term treatment is that you can later transition into long-term rehab. Therefore, this form of rehabilitation is ideal for people in Wayne who have either relapsed or are at risk of relapse because they can surround themselves in another drug-free setting to continue effectively battling their addiction.

After you finish and leave a rehab program, it is highly typical that you will find yourself near the same surroundings where you previously used substances prior to going to rehab. This is due to the fact that the same triggers - people, situations, and environment - that can provoke you to start using again are still there.

Since it can be extremely challenging to shift back into a new sober life after leaving long-term treatment where you were able to focus on healing and therapy for several months, you may feel that continuing on with short term rehab in Wayne, ME. may potentially help you hold on to your newly found abstinence, resolve, and conceptions against substance abuse.

While in short term rehab, therefore, you will learn how to lead a more productive life regardless of any difficulties you may run into. The program will also help you to learn to think and act differently - which could prove useful in ensuring that you are able to handle any stress you encounter.

Additional components of substance abuse treatment and continued care include:

  • How to recognize triggers and avoid them
  • How to surround yourself with support through community groups, outpatient treatment, and stays at sober living facilities
  • How to create a more favorable environment at home and work

Finally, short term drug rehab will typically have a vast variety of treatment methods that will help you use new skills in your life and keep on sticking to the new philosophies and morals you have learned once you leave the rehabilitation facility.
